Elton Cardigan



 Elton is a basic knit cardigan with a mix of stripes and texture. It has a relaxed boxy fit and it is slightly cropped.  A perfect garment for lounging and relaxing to knit and wear. It’s worked seamlessly from the top down.

Cardigan is knit from top down. You will be working in the round and using German short row for shaping. There will be around 16" of positive ease. You will be doing strips and caring yarn up the side.

Needles: US 2½ (3 mm) and 4 (3.5 mm) circular needles, 32” long. You will need a spare needle in the same size if you plan to use a tubular bind off. Other notions: 7, 8, or, 9 (5/8”) wide buttons. Stitch holders, tapestry needle, markers and extra cables or stitch saver. Refer to pattern for size and yarn amounts. 

You will need to do a GAUGE swatch to determine what need size needle you will need and to ensure proper fit.  This Cardigan has 16" of positive ease. Also, if you want it longer you may need more yarn.

GAUGE 20.5 sts and 36 rows to 4” (10cm) in stockinette stitch FLAT on US 4 (3.5 mm) needles (body) after stretching out the fabric when blocking. 25 sts and 36 rows to 4” (10cm) in stockinette stitch IN THE ROUND on US 4 (3.5 mm) needles (sleeves) without stretching the fabric when blocking.
